Kowalczyk has amassed two decades of collegiate coaching experience. He came to Green Bay from Marquette University, where he served as an assistant coach. While with the Golden Eagles, Kowalczyk coordinated efforts that outfitted consecutive top-25 recruiting classes in Marquette uniforms.

Before joining Tom Crean's staff at Marquette, Kowalczyk spent three years coaching in the Big East Conference at Rutgers, including one season as associate head coach. Kowalczyk helped land two recruiting classes ranked among the top 15 nationally that led the Scarlet Knights to consecutive NIT appearances.

Tod Kowalczyk has been a head coach every year of the Kenpom era:

Green Bay: 203, 156, 179, 187, 143, 83, 142
Toledo: 334, 202, 190, 107

I know that KP ranks are not everything and circumstances/context is needed but in my opinion the results over 12 years isn't good enough mid major production to warrant an ACC job.
